Transforming Caller Management with AI-Powered Call Direction & Processes

Modern enterprises are increasingly leveraging automated call routing and automation fueled by artificial intelligence to deliver exceptional client experiences and streamline operations. This approach moves beyond traditional IVR systems, utilizing AI to analyze caller needs in real-time and swiftly route them to the appropriate agent. Beyond that, AI-driven automation can handle routine inquiries, such as password updates, order status inquiries, or basic product information, freeing up human agents to focus on more complex issues. This results in reduced wait delays, increased agent productivity, and ultimately, higher client satisfaction.
